Court Yard Hounds Highlight NVOH Summer Festival, 7/10

Tomorrow (Saturday, July 3) kicks off the Robert Mondavi Winery / Napa Valley Opera House Summer Festival with the Preservation Hall Jazz Band and fireworks. Tickets are still available and will be available for purchase at the winery. Gates open at 5pm, the concert starts at 7pm. More information is available at nvoh.org/mondavi.

The second performance in the Robert Mondavi Winery / Napa Valley Opera House Summer Festival features the Court Yard Hounds, comprised of former Dixie Chicks Emily Robison and Martie Maguire. This performance will be Saturday, July 10 at 7pm. Tickets are $75 - $205 and can be reserved by calling 707.226.7372 or visiting NVOH.org.

The "Hounds" are in the midst of a busy summer tour, which includes several dates with the 2010 Lilith Fair and a recent appearance at the Telluride Bluegrass Festival. Opening for the band is up-and-coming artist Griffin House. Among other critical acclaim, CBS Sunday Morning critic Bill Flanagan raved about House's first album, Lost and Found, putting the newcomer on his short list of the best emerging songwriters in the U.S., alongside Ray LaMontagne and Joseph Arthur.

As the mainstays of the Dixie Chicks since they formed the group in 1989, sisters Martie Maguire and Emily Robison have been familiar faces to many millions of fans. "Chicks" fans couldn't help but hear those ever-present harmonies and wonder if Emily and Martie might ever come out from hiding in plain sight. That's just what they've done in their newly hatched incarnation as Court Yard Hounds, with a debut album that has the siblings sounding like they've been fearless front women all their lives.
